My Woman

by Nowhere Man   Sep 2, 2011


Let me explore you my woman
your body, mind, soul and depths.
Indulge me to the garden of your universe
where you plant all your secrets.

I'll be yours alone forever
no matter what I'll discover
I'll requite you by unfolding mine,
soon our worlds shall meet entwine.

You can look me in the eye,
restrain me to tell you no lies
If that assures you all of my love
only for you as pure as a dove.

Like the most beautiful flower, I'll tend you
adore, smell, taste, touch and kiss you too
My only escape from this life of tedium,
in you I'll lay my trust and religion.

So as the world turns through time,
just let me call you my own and mine;
my woman, my love, my revelry.
I'll stand by you whatever fate decrees...
